Vimeo is the second company in just as many weeks to feel the burn of a user backlash. Recent news of Vimeo’s Terms of Service hasn’t been met with open arms. This comes just weeks after the Facebook fiasco that sparked an unprecedented reaction from executives and strategist at the social media giant. As many of you already know, that reaction resulted in the now ‘community led‘ approach to Terms of Service definition at Facebook.
Vimeo, who currently maintain a similar definition of content ownership in their ToS are now faced with some difficult decisions.
